Spring 2026 figures are Pre-Appeals. ADE has not yet run the appeals and corrections cycle for this release, so these numbers can still change. At this stage ADE's statewide total also runs slightly above the sum of its own districts (between +0.006% and +0.184% depending on the subject), because some test records are not yet attributed to a school. Spring 2024 and Spring 2025, both final releases, reconcile exactly. How we handle this.

The headline number only counts Levels 3 and 4. Movement from Level 1 to Level 2 is real progress that the headline hides, so the full distribution is shown. Above each bar, ▲ is the share ready or exceeding (Levels 3–4); below it, ▼ is the share in need of support or close (Levels 1–2).

The whole distribution, with this school marked. We report a quartile band rather than a precise rank: across a field this tight, a rank implies a precision the data does not support.

Schools like this one

Comparing a school only with the state average tells you as much about who enrolls there as about what it does. These are the 12 closest schools by economic disadvantage, size, English-learner share, special-education share and grade span.

12 nearest schools in the same grade-span band, by rank-normalized distance over economically-disadvantaged % (MSI), log enrollment (SIS), English-learner % (MSI) and special-education % (MSI), equally weighted. Peer medians are computed, not published by ADE; peers below 30 tested students are excluded and counted above.
